Webb1 apr. 2024 · Some types of premises are exempt from business rates. This includes: agricultural land and buildings fish farms rural premises with Automatic Telling Machines (ATMs) oil and gas pipelines overseas armed forces premises in the UK This list is not exhaustive. Rural Rate Relief is a 100-per-cent discount on business rates in England available in certain circumstances to businesses located in rural areas with a population below 3,000. WebbRural Rate Relief. Certain types of business in rural villages with a population below 3,000 may be entitled to relief of 100%. The business must be the only general store, food …

WebbIf your business property is in a rural area with a population less than 3,000, you may get rate relief. To get this, your property must be the only general store, post office, food shop, pub or petrol station in the area, with a rateable value less than certain levels.
